What Is Loose Parts Play?

Loose-parts play allows children to interact with a variety of materials that can be manipulated in different ways. These items could be natural, like pinecones and acorns, or household objects such as fabric scraps, buttons, and string.

The beauty of this play style is its open-ended nature—kids aren’t following specific instructions, but instead using their creativity to experiment, build, and explore.

Benefits of Loose Parts Play

  • Creativity: With no predetermined purpose, kids can explore materials in endless ways, building unique creations.
  • Fine motor skills: Picking up and manipulating small objects like acorns or berries strengthens hand-eye coordination.
  • Problem-solving: Loose parts play encourages critical thinking, as kids figure out how to balance items, build structures, or combine objects.
  • Independence: Kids take the lead in their play, making their own decisions about how to use the materials.

Sample of Fall Loose Parts:

pinecones

acorns

leaves

gourds

sticks

driftwood

pumpkin seeds and insides
